Developing Inner Wisdom and Empathy
As we navigate the complexities of modern life, it's increasingly important to cultivate a deeper understanding of ourselves and those around us. This involves developing inner wisdom – the ability to listen to our intuition, trust our instincts, and make decisions that align with our values and goals. Simultaneously, cultivating empathy allows us to connect with others on a profound level, fostering meaningful relationships and a sense of community.
The Power of Self-Awareness
Self-awareness is the foundation upon which inner wisdom and empathy are built. By developing a greater understanding of our thoughts, emotions, and motivations, we can better navigate life's challenges and make choices that align with our true selves. This involves setting aside time for introspection, mindfulness, and self-reflection – practices that help us tune into our internal compass and make decisions that honor our values.
Cultivating Empathy in Daily Life
Empathy is not just a feeling; it's an action-oriented approach to understanding others. By actively listening to those around us, we can begin to see the world from their perspective, fostering deeper connections and more meaningful relationships. This involves practicing active listening, asking open-ended questions, and engaging with people from diverse backgrounds and experiences.

Practicing Self-Compassion
Self-compassion is a crucial aspect of developing inner wisdom and empathy. By treating ourselves with kindness, understanding, and patience – just as we would a close friend – we create a safe space for growth, exploration, and self-discovery. This involves practicing mindfulness, acknowledging our imperfections, and refraining from self-criticism.
